JetBrains IDE-k útmutatója 2025-re

2025-07-29 09:00
JetBrains IDE-k áttekintése: mikor melyiket érdemes választani, milyen funkciókra számíthatsz, és mire figyelj, ha most kezdesz fejleszteni.
JetBrains IDE-k útmutatója 2025-re

A JetBrains IDE-ket 2001 óta több mint 18 millió fejlesztő használta sikeresen, így bizonyítottan bevált és kipróbált megoldásoknak lehet őket nevezni. Lássuk a JetBrains IDE-k főbb jellemzőit, különbségeit és azt, hogyan találhatod meg a személyes vagy csapatos igényekhez leginkább illő eszközt!

Miért különlegesek a JetBrains IDE-ek?

Intelligens kódtámogatás és automatizáció

A JetBrains IDE-k beépített intelligens kitöltéssel, kódelemzéssel, hibajavaslatokkal és refaktoráló eszközökkel rendelkezik.Az intelligens kódelemzés, a nagy teljesítményű keresőfunkciók, a fejlett (például mesterséges intelligencián alapuló) szolgáltatások, valamint a könnyű használhatóság kombinációja lehetővé teszi, hogy rövidebb idő alatt magasabb minőségű szoftvert hozz létre.

A fejlett elemzőmechanizmusok lehetővé teszik a hibák korai leleplezését, miközben folyamatosan javaslatokat tesznek a kódminőség javítására, például a Python vagy Java fejlesztés során .

Használatra kész fejlesztőkörnyezet

A fejlesztőkörnyezetet és minden előnyét kifejezetten a fő programozási nyelvedhez és a hozzá kapcsolódó technológiai stackhez terveztek. Már a telepítés után, alapból tartalmazzák a mindennapi munkához szükséges összes fontos eszközt. Verziókezelést, adatbázis-kezelő eszközöket, egységtesztelést és még sok mást.

Erőteljes refaktorálási lehetőségek

Az IDE-k lehetővé teszik például változónevek átnevezését, metódus-kivonást vagy akár függvényképletek változtatását csak néhány kattintással. Ezek az eszközök különösen hasznosak nagy, legacy kódok átalakításánál.

Testreszabhatóság: pluginok és UI

Minden JetBrains IDE hozzáfér a JetBrains Marketplace hatalmas plugin-tárához, ahol témák, nyelvi támogatások, eszközök (Docker, Kubernetes, markdown szerkesztők stb.) közül válogathatsz. A felhasználói felület (témák, zen mód, eszköztárak) is teljes mértékben testreszabható, így mindig a neked megfelelő módon dolgozhatsz.

Mivel JetBrains összes fejlesztőkörnyeze egy közös platformra épül, ha már megtanultad használni az egyiket, gyakorlatilag az összeset ismered.

Melyik IDE való neked?

A JetBrains „Choose Your IDE” oldala segít kiválasztani az adott technológiához leginkább illő IDE-t:

  • CLion (ingyenes nem kereskedelmi felhasználásra): C, C++, CMake, Embedded, SQL, Assembly
  • DataGrip: MySQL, PostgreSQL, Oracle, SQL Server, MongoDB, Redis
  • GoLand: Go (Golang), JavaScript, TypeScript, SQL, React
  • IntelliJ IDEA: Java, Kotlin, Spring, Jakarta EE, JavaScript, TypeScript, SQL, Scala
  • PhpStorm: PHP, Laravel, Symfony, WordPress, JavaScript, TypeScript
  • PyCharm: Python, Django, Jupyter, SQL, JavaScript, Flask
  • ReSharper: C#, .NET, ASP.NET, VB.NET
  • Rider (ingyenes nem kereskedelmi felhasználásra): C#, .NET, ASP.NET, F#, Unity, Unreal Engine
  • RubyMine: Ruby on Rails (RoR), Hotwire, RuboCop, RSpec, React, Vue.js
  • RustRover (ingyenes nem kereskedelmi felhasználásra): Rust, SQL, JavaScript, TypeScript, Cargo
  • WebStorm (ingyenes nem kereskedelmi felhasználásra): JavaScript, TypeScript, React, Vue, Angular

Telepítés és rendszerkövetelmények

A JetBrains Toolbox App az ajánlott telepítési mód: egyszerű, lehetővé teszi több termék és verzió kezelését (például EAP és stabil build-ek között való váltást), rollbacket és licenckezelést egy helyen . A Toolbox mellett elérhető standalone telepítés Windows, macOS és Linux rendszerekre is. Minimum 2 GB RAM, de ajánlott 8 GB vagy több egy nagyobb projekt gördülékeny kezeléséhez.

JetBrains IDE-k testreszabása és beállításai

Beállítások szintezése

IntelliJ esetében alkalmazhatsz modul-, projekt‑ vagy globális szintű beállításokat is. A globális beállítások (pl. undo, témák, pluginok) minden projektben érvényesek ugyanazzal az IDE telepítéssel.

Szinkronizáció

A JetBrains Settings Sync funkcióval konfigurációid (billentyűparancsok, téma, plugin lista stb.) akár több IDE és gép között is automatikusan szinkronban tarthatók.

Fontos tuningok

Lehetőség van a futtatási környezet (JDK) változtatására: az IDE alapértelmezés szerint JetBrains Runtime (Java 17‑es alapú) környezetet használ, szükség esetén átválthatsz más JDK 21 verzióra is.

Tippek, bevált gyakorlatok

  1. Fedezd fel a plugin-eket: a JetBrains Marketplace rengeteg hasznos bővítményt kínál!
  2. Tanuld meg a billentyűparancsokat: Ctrl+Shift+A (Windows/Linux) vagy Cmd+Shift+A (macOS) a parancs‑kereső, egyéni gyorshívásokat is létrehozhatsz!
  3. Próbáld ki a Zen Mode‑ot: minimalista UI a fókuszált kódoláshoz, segít kizárni a zavaró elemeket!

Gyakori buktatók, amiket érdemes elkerülni

  • Túl sok funkció: A JetBrains IDE-k rengeteg funkcióval rendelkeznek, ami elsőre zsúfoltnak tűnhet. Ajánlott fokozatosan haladni kezdve az alapfunkciókkal, majd haladóbb eszközök felfedezésével.
  • Teljesítményproblémák: Nagy projektek esetén szükség lehet extra RAM-ra, illetve a pluginok és memóriabeállítások optimalizálására.
  • Meredek tanulási görbe: A funkciók sokrétűsége eleinte kihívást jelenthet, de szerencsére rengeteg, tanulást segítő anyag áll rendelkezésedre. Nézz körül blogokban, útmutatókban és videókban, ahol lépésről lépésre levezetik neked a folyamatot!

Biztonság

A JetBrains eszközei megfelelnek az iparágban vezető, globális biztonsági szabványoknak – beleértve a SOC 2 tanúsítványt is –, így biztosítva, hogy szervezeted adatai védettek legyenek. Minden szükséges dokumentum elérhető a Trust Centerben.

Összegzés

A JetBrains termékek prémium szintű kódtámogatást, integrált eszközöket, plugin‑gazdagságot és cross‑platform élményt kínálnak, Mindezek együttesen alkotják azt az élményt, amiért oly sok fejlesztő elköteleződik mellettük. Függetlenül attól, hogy éppen milyen projekten dolgozol, a JetBrains IDE-k képesek növelni a minőségét, miközben felgyorsítják a munkafolyamatot.

Termékek
Tanfolyamok

Olvass tovább


JetBrains IDE-k útmutatója 2025-re

JetBrains IDE-k áttekintése: mikor melyiket érdemes választani, milyen funkciókra számíthatsz, és mire figyelj, ha most kezdesz fejleszteni.

,
Így készülj a karrieredre - Tökéletes önéletrajz az Adobe Acrobattal!

Fedezd fel, hogyan készíthetsz profi, pályakezdő önéletrajzot már egyetem alatt az Adobe Acrobat és beépített AI asszisztens segítségével.

,
[MEGHÍVÓ]: Adobe Project Neo webinár

A grafikai tervezés jövője már itt van!
Fedezd fel az Adobe vadonatúj fejlesztését, a Project Neo-t webinárunk keretében, és pillants bele a kreatív világ következő szintjébe!

Copyright © 2023 Trans-Europe Zrt. Minden jog fenntartva.
linkedin facebook pinterest youtube rss twitter instagram facebook-blank rss-blank linkedin-blank pinterest youtube twitter instagram